summaryrefslogtreecommitdiffstats
path: root/drivers/fsi
AgeCommit message (Expand)AuthorLines
2018-08-08fsi: sbefifo: Bump max command lengthBenjamin Herrenschmidt-7/+32
2018-08-06fsi: scom: Fix NULL dereferenceBenjamin Herrenschmidt-0/+1
2018-07-27fsi: Prevent multiple concurrent rescansBenjamin Herrenschmidt-2/+16
2018-07-27fsi: Add cfam char devicesBenjamin Herrenschmidt-51/+213
2018-07-27fsi: scom: Convert to use the new chardevBenjamin Herrenschmidt-50/+80
2018-07-27fsi: sbefifo: Convert to use the new chardevBenjamin Herrenschmidt-29/+55
2018-07-27fsi: Add new central chardev supportBenjamin Herrenschmidt-2/+108
2018-07-26fsi: master-ast-cf: Rename dump_trace() to avoid name collisionBenjamin Herrenschmidt-5/+5
2018-07-26fsi: master-ast-cf: Fix memory leakGustavo A. R. Silva-2/+4
2018-07-25fsi: master-ast-cf: Mask unused bits in RTAG/RCRCBenjamin Herrenschmidt-2/+2
2018-07-24fsi: master-ast-cf: Fix build warnings on 64-bit platformsBenjamin Herrenschmidt-2/+2
2018-07-23fsi: Add support for device-tree provided chip IDsBenjamin Herrenschmidt-0/+24
2018-07-23fsi: sbefifo: Fix inconsistent use of ffdc mutexBenjamin Herrenschmidt-4/+9
2018-07-23fsi: master-ast-cf: Add new FSI master using Aspeed ColdFireBenjamin Herrenschmidt-0/+1605
2018-07-12fsi: Move various master definitions to a common headerBenjamin Herrenschmidt-29/+33
2018-07-12fsi: master-gpio: Add missing release functionBenjamin Herrenschmidt-18/+35
2018-07-12fsi: Don't use device_unregister() in fsi_master_register()Benjamin Herrenschmidt-5/+2
2018-07-12fsi: master-gpio: Remove "GPIO" prefix on some definitionsBenjamin Herrenschmidt-34/+36
2018-07-12fsi: master-gpio: Remove unused definitionsBenjamin Herrenschmidt-6/+0
2018-07-12fsi: master-gpio: Add more tracepointsBenjamin Herrenschmidt-6/+10
2018-07-12fsi: master-gpio: Add support for link_configBenjamin Herrenschmidt-2/+25
2018-07-12fsi: master-gpio: Rename and adjust send delayBenjamin Herrenschmidt-3/+6
2018-07-12fsi: Add mechanism to set the tSendDelay and tEchoDelay valuesBenjamin Herrenschmidt-18/+93
2018-07-12fsi: Move code around to avoid forward declarationBenjamin Herrenschmidt-48/+46
2018-07-12fsi: sbefifo: Fix checker warning about late NULL checkBenjamin Herrenschmidt-2/+5
2018-07-12fsi/sbefifo: Add dependency on OF_ADDRESSGuenter Roeck-0/+1
2018-07-12fsi: sbefifo: Add missing mutex_unlockEddie James-0/+1
2018-06-18fsi: scom: Major overhaulBenjamin Herrenschmidt-30/+394
2018-06-18fsi: scom: Add register definitionsBenjamin Herrenschmidt-1/+18
2018-06-18fsi: scom: Fixup endian annotationsBenjamin Herrenschmidt-5/+4
2018-06-18fsi: scom: Whitespace fixesBenjamin Herrenschmidt-4/+4
2018-06-18fsi: scom: Add mutex around FSI2PIB accessesBenjamin Herrenschmidt-7/+18
2018-06-18fsi: core: Fix sparse warningsJoel Stanley-10/+13
2018-06-18fsi: master-hub: Fix sparse warningsJoel Stanley-2/+3
2018-06-18fsi: sbefifo: Fix sparse warningsJoel Stanley-2/+3
2018-06-14fsi: sbefifo: Remove unneeded semicolonBenjamin Herrenschmidt-1/+1
2018-06-12fsi/sbefifo: Add driver for the SBE FIFOBenjamin Herrenschmidt-0/+1013
2018-06-12fsi: scom: Remove PIB reset during probeEddie James-8/+0
2018-06-12fsi/master-gpio: Replace bit_bit lock with IRQ disable/enableJeremy Kerr-25/+23
2018-06-12fsi/fsi-master-gpio: More error handling cleanupBenjamin Herrenschmidt-21/+5
2018-06-12fsi/fsi-master-gpio: Implement CRC error recoveryBenjamin Herrenschmidt-18/+72
2018-06-12fsi/gpio: Use relative-addressing commandsJeremy Kerr-11/+91
2018-06-12fsi/gpio: Include command build in locked sectionJeremy Kerr-7/+18
2018-06-12fsi/fsi-master-gpio: Delay sampling of FSI data inputBenjamin Herrenschmidt-0/+5
2018-06-12fsi/fsi-master-gpio: Reduce dpoll clocksBenjamin Herrenschmidt-2/+3
2018-06-12fsi/fsi-master-gpio: Reduce turnaround clocksBenjamin Herrenschmidt-1/+1
2018-06-12fsi/fsi-master-gpio: Add "no-gpio-delays" optionBenjamin Herrenschmidt-4/+16
2018-06-12fsi/fsi-master-gpio: Sample input data on different clock phaseBenjamin Herrenschmidt-3/+5
2018-06-12fsi: gpio: Use a mutex to protect transfersJeremy Kerr-22/+64
2018-06-12fsi: gpio: Remove unused 'id' variableAndrew Jeffery-2/+1